缺血预处理减轻白细胞致肾急性缺血再灌注损伤的作用

The role of the ischemic preconditioning in alleviating the renal injury by WBC for acute ischemia -reperfusion
下载PDF
导出
摘要 采用家兔急性肾缺血再灌注损伤模型,研究缺血预处理(ischemic preconditioning,IPC)减轻白细胞致肾损伤的作用。实验分:IPC、缺血再灌注(inchemic reperfusion,IR)和对照组。均去右肾,检测在缺血前、缺血60min和再灌注60min、120min时混合静脉血中的白细胞总数和再灌120min时左肾系数(Left renal coefficient,LRC)、肾组织中的白细胞数以及过氧化脂质(Lipid peroxides,LPO)含量,并在光镜下对再灌120min时的肾小管的病理变化进行评分。结果表明:IR组在再灌注120min时,以上指标同对照组和IPC组比较,差异显著(P<0.05~0.01),血中白细胞数与LPO、LRC、肾小管评分的改变呈正相关(P<0.05),肾组织中白细胞数与LRC、肾小管评分呈正相关(P<0.05),IPC组肾组织中白细胞数显著低于对照组(P<0.01)。提示:白细胞在急性肾缺血再灌注损伤中是一个重要因素,IPC具有减轻白细胞所致的肾损伤作用。 The role of the ischemic preconditioning(IPC) in alleviating the renal jnjury by WBC for acute ischemia reperfusion was investigated by use of the model of acute ischemia reperfusion in rabbits. The experiments were porformed in right nephrectomy in IPC ,ischemia reperfusion (IR) and control groups. The WBC in blood was counted respectively before ischemia,at 60 min after ischemia and at 60 min,120 min after reperfusion. Left renal coefficient (LRC) , Lipid peroxides(LPO) and WBC in kidney were detected and the pathologic changes in tubules were scored in light microscope at 120 min after reperfusion. The results indicated there are significant differences in indexes above comparing the IR with the IPC and control at .120 min after reperfusion (p<0. 05 - 0. 01) ,and the changes of WBC in blood were positive related to the LPO,LRC and scores of the tubules,WBC in kidney were positive related to the LRC and scores of tubules (P<0. 05). However,compared with control,the indexes of the IPC are not significantly changed,but WBC in kidney significantly decreased (P<0. 01). It suggested WBC is an im-portmant factor in renal injury,and the IPC plays a role in alleviating renal injury by WBC with ischemia reperfusion.
